School Psychologist Responsibilities Administer, interpret, and utilize psychological tests, functional behavior assessments, and other evaluation materials to complete comprehensive reports Participate in the RTI process for scholars with confirmed or suspected special needs and in the subsequent planning of educational programs. Discuss evaluation results and meaningful recommendations as related to the referral question Help school teams use evaluation and observation data to plan instruction that will help scholars meet learning standards and access curriculum Identify scholars in need of support and/or referral services through observation, data collection, informal evaluation, and formal evaluation, and assist school personnel in the implementation and coordination of appropriate action steps Work in collaboration with the student support team Assist school teams in developing, implementing, and monitoring behavior intervention plans Provide ongoing consultation and modeling of therapeutic strategies for teaching teams and support staff Maintain accurate, complete, and comprehensive scholar and staff records as required by law, district policy, and administrative regulations Manage an assessment caseload to maintain strict adherence to all assessment timelines pursuant to special education guidelines Certification in relevant psychological field CPI Certified Qualifications Advanced degree in school psychology required Bilingual candidates strongly preferred, but not required Successful applicants must hold an appropriate Rhode Island certification and licensure by their date of hire.
